It's not typical for your kitchen area sink to clog up numerous times in one month. If your sink obstructs twice a week, there's some trouble going on.
A blocked kitchen drainpipe does not simply decrease your tasks, it degrades your whole plumbing system, gradually. Right here are some common habits that urge sink clogs, as well as how to prevent them.

You require appropriate waste disposal


Recycling waste is wonderful, yet do you focus on your organic waste also? Your kitchen area ought to have two different waste boxes; one for recyclable plastics and an additional for organic waste, which can come to be compost.
Having actually an assigned trash can will aid you and your family stay clear of throwing pasta and also other food remnants away. Usually, these remnants soak up wetness and end up being clogs.

A person attempted to wash their hair in the cooking area sink


There's a right time and also location for every little thing. The kitchen area sink is simply not the right area to wash your hair. Cleaning your hair in the kitchen sink will make it obstruct eventually unless you make use of a drain catcher.
While a drainpipe catcher might catch the majority of the results, some strands might still get through. If you have thick hair, this might be enough to reduce your drain and also ultimately create a clog.

You're tossing coffee down the drain


Utilized coffee grounds as well as coffee beans still soak up a considerable quantity of wetness. They might seem little enough to throw down the drainpipe, but as time goes on they start to swell and occupy more area.
Your coffee premises ought to enter into organic garbage disposal. Whatever portion leaves (probably while you're washing up) will certainly be cared for during your regular monthly cleanup.

You've been consuming a lot of greasy foods


Your cooking area sink might still get obstructed despite having organic garbage disposal. This might be because you have a diet plan abundant in greasy foods like cheeseburgers.
This grease coats the insides of pipelines, making them narrower and also even more clog-prone.

Your pipe wasn't taken care of appropriately to begin with


If you have actually been doing none of the above, but still get regular blockages in your cooking area sink, you ought to call a plumber. There may be a trouble with how your pipes were set up.
While your plumber gets here, look for any leaks or abnormalities around your cooking area pipelines. Don't attempt to take care of the pipelines on your own. This might cause a mishap or a kitchen area flooding.

There's even more dust than your pipes can deal with


If you get fruits straight from a ranch, you might notice more kitchen area dirt than other individuals that go shopping from a shopping mall. You can easily fix this by cleaning up the fruits as well as veggies appropriately prior to bringing them right into your house.

Melt the sludge


  • 1. Pour one-half cup baking soda into the drain complied with by half mug white vinegar; the fizzy and also bubbling response aids to separate tiny obstructions.

  • 2. Block the drainpipe making use of a tiny dustcloth so the chain reaction doesn't all bubble up out.

  • 3. Wait 15 minutes.

  • 4. Currently put a pot's well worth of boiling thin down the drainpipe and also run warm water for numerous minutes to additional eliminate the melted scum.

    5 Things to Do if You Want to Unclog Your Kitchen Sink


    Trick 1: Don’t Put Vegetable Peelings Down Disposal



    Although the garbage disposal is a powerful and useful way to get rid of food waste, it is not meant for certain vegetables. Don’t put potato, carrot or celery peelings down the disposal. These veggies are fibrous or contain a lot of starch which can jam the disposal motor and clog your sink drain-piping every time. There are other food items that occasionally will clog your sink. If this happens, follow the next four tips.


    Trick 2: Use Your Plunger


    Plunger is a must-have tool for every household because it can be used to unclog any drain in any part of the house including the kitchen. Yes, the simple plunger can unclog your kitchen sink too. When you use the plunger, plug the other holes in you kitchen sink with a rag cloth. Also, ensure that the plunger cup completely covers the clogged kitchen sink hole. Now, keep the plunger in an upright position and plunge about ten times vigorously. This should remove any vegetable peels, food leftovers or any other solids in the kitchen sink.


    Trick 3: Clear the P-trap


    The P-trap is the pipe below your sink that’s shaped like the letter P (on its side). You should be able to spot it when you look in the cabinet below your sink. This pipe, shaped to provide a seal against sewer odors, gets clogged when receiving larger solid objects. To unclog the P-trap, you need a pair of gloves and a bucket. You should unscrew the large nut on both the sides of the trap with your bare hands and remove the pipe. Make sure you place a bucket right below the trap to collect all the unclogged water. You can also run your hands through the pipe to remove any solid objects.


    Trick 4: Use a Metal Wire


    Sometimes using a metal wire to push down or pull up debris from your drain can help unclog your kitchen sink. If you don’t have a metal wire, unbend a wire hanger and use it in the kitchen drain hole. Since this is time-consuming, you’d only use this trick as a last resort. It works well when you know what’s inside the drain.


    Trick 5: Use a Drain Snake


    Go to your local hardware store and buy a short manual-crank drain snake. This tool is fairly inexpensive and works well unless the clog is further down the drain, past the P-trap.



    If none of the above tricks work, then you should call an expert right away, especially since clogged drains are the perfect breeding ground for all kinds of bacteria and viruses.
